## Specifications

| Spec | Value |
| --- | --- |
| Price (US) | $434 |
| Brand | Asus |
| Released | 2024-03 |
| CPU | Intel Core 3 100U (base); up to Core Ultra 7 155H |
| Max RAM (GB) | 96 |
| Storage type | M.2 2280 PCIe 4.0 NVMe + M.2 2242 PCIe 4.0 + 2.5" SATA (tall chassis) |
| Wi-Fi standard | Wi-Fi 6E (Intel AX211) |
| Ethernet | 2.5 GbE (Intel I226-V) |
| Ports summary | 2x Thunderbolt 4 (rear, DP2.1/USB4), 1x USB-C 3.2 Gen2x2 (front), 2x USB-A 3.2 Gen2 (front), 1x USB-A 3.2 Gen2 (rear), 1x USB-A 2.0 (rear), 2x HDMI 2.1 (rear) |
| Dimensions (mm) | 117 x 112 x 54 |

## What reviewers say

Three whitelisted hands-on reviews — Notebookcheck, Tom's Guide and TechRadar — benchmarked the Asus NUC 14 Pro (Intel Core Ultra, 2024). All three highlight its uncommon dual Thunderbolt 4 ports and strong CPU/Arc iGPU performance for the tiny footprint, and all three flag the high price / weak value versus cheaper similarly specced rivals. The plastic case, missing 3.5mm audio jack and fan noise/thermals under sustained load draw the main criticism. Every quote and benchmark listed was verified as a literal match against the fetched source text. (Based on 3 reviews, 3 lab-tested, 2024-05-23–2024-12-08.)

Praised: Dual Thunderbolt 4 ports, rare among mini PCs in this class; Strong CPU and Arc iGPU performance for the compact size; Expandable storage/RAM with easy, near-tool-free internal access.
Flagged: Plastic case rather than metal, unremarkable build; No 3.5mm audio jack anywhere on the unit; Expensive / weak value versus similarly specced rivals; Fan noise and high CPU thermals under sustained load.
Disagreement: Reviewers split on value and internal design. TechRadar calls the NUC 14 Pro 'underwhelming' and overpriced and slams the delicate ribbon-cable base plate as not truly tool-free, whereas Tom's Guide is broadly positive and praises the easy upgradability; Notebookcheck sits in the middle at a 74.7% rating, noting the barebone price is 'a lot' versus competitors.
